Design excerpt — Tollgrange tax-rate cache. Rates change infrequently but must never be stale past a filing boundary, so the cache uses a short TTL with background refresh rather than invalidation hooks. Misses fall through to the Verisette rate service with a bounded retry. Maintainers should tune TTL and refresh jitter together. Current constants follow.

constants for tafog-kahag:
RATE_LIMITS = {
    "sorir": 697,
    "oliox": 683,
    "holax": 176,
    "casox": 60,
    "pelius": 382,
}

## Releases

Branchreaper releases ship monthly from the `stable` branch. The cleanup bot itself is versioned and signed; CI rejects unsigned artifacts. As a contractor, you don't cut releases, but you may need to verify a build locally before testing against staging. Verification uses the project's public deploy key, shown below.

deploy key for kajof-fajop: bky6_gDHw9Q

Subject: DR drill next Thursday — broker upgrade included

Hi Soren,

Quick heads-up before your review: we're folding the Quillbus broker upgrade (3.9 → 4.1) into next Thursday's disaster-recovery drill at the Marnefield site. Plan is to fail over to the standby cluster, run the upgrade there, then cut back. Nothing exotic, but I'd love your eyes on the queue-mirroring config. To rejoin the drill vault if you get locked out mid-exercise, use the passphrase below.

unlock words, yawig-kagef: gordor-holvan-ulaael-pramir-ulaiel-tamdor

**Ticket PFD-441: Stage env misconfigured during FD-leak hunt**

While chasing the leaked file descriptors in the Snapfeed poller, we discovered staging was pointing at the prod broker, which is why lsof counts never matched. Fixed the host var, but the poller also needs its auth entry restored — someone blew it away when copying the template. Future maintainers: don't trust `env.stage.example`, it's stale. The missing line goes right here, immediately below this note.

env line for fafof-fahag: LEDGER_TOKEN5=f8790

☐ Thumbnail Generation Queue (Snapgrove Media Platform): Verify that the queue depth stays below 5,000 jobs during peak hours, that failed renders are retried no more than three times, and that stale entries older than 48 hours are purged automatically. New team members should confirm these checks weekly. The accountable owner is named below.

account owner for bawip-tahag: Raleth Quenok